Job Function

The Chief Administrative Officer will oversee corporate services, including facilities management, enterprise operations support, administrative policy governance, shared services, enterprise risk coordination, and strategic business operations alignment.

The CAO will ensure seamless integration across clinical, operational, and corporate administrative functions while driving efficiency, compliance, and enterprise-wide operational cohesion.


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Lead enterprise-wide administrative strategy across hospital networks and corporate functions
  • Oversee facilities operations, infrastructure services, and enterprise support functions
  • Develop governance frameworks for administrative policy compliance across regions
  • Drive operational efficiency and cost optimization across shared services
  • Coordinate cross-functional administrative initiatives across clinical and non-clinical divisions
  • Oversee vendor governance and large-scale service contracts
  • Guide enterprise risk coordination across operational domains
  • Lead business continuity planning and disaster recovery administrative oversight
  • Align workforce administration, compliance, and support services with regulatory requirements
  • Oversee administrative budgeting and capital allocation for support services
  • Support digital transformation initiatives across enterprise support systems
  • Provide executive-level reporting on operational performance metrics
  • Ensure alignment between administrative functions and patient-centered care delivery
